Abstract
Aims: ST-segment recovery (2STR) and myocardial blush (MB) evaluate different elements of microcirculatory integrity after reperfusion therapy in acute myocardial infarction (AMI). We sought to determine whether the combination of 2STR and MB after primary percutaneous coronary intervention (PCI) in AMI has greater prognostic utility than either measure alone. Methods and results: The 30 days and 1 year clinical outcomes of 456 patients were assessed as a function of ΣSTR and MB after primary PCI from the CADILLAC trial. ΣSTR and MB were concordant (≥70% ΣSTR and MB grade 2/3 or <70% ΣSTR and MB grade 0/1) in 60.1% of patients and discordant in 39.9% of patients. The greatest survival was observed among patients with complete ΣSTR (≥70%) and MB grade 2/3 in whom the cumulative rates of death at 30 days and 1 year were 0.6 and 1.2%, respectively. Poorest survival was observed among patients with incomplete ΣSTR (<70%) and reduced MB (grade 0/1), in whom 30 days and 1 year rates of death were 8.3 and 10.1%, respectively. Intermediate outcomes were present in patients with discordant MB and 2STR. By multivariable analysis, however, ΣSTR was an independent correlate of survival at 30 days and 1 year (P = 0.05 and 0.01, respectively), whereas MB was no longer predictive (P = 0.38 and 0.72, respectively). Conclusion: ΣSTR and MB are not infrequently discordant after primary PCI. By univariate analysis, both measures of reperfusion success strongly correlate with survival and assessment of both yields incremental prognostic information beyond either measure alone. By multivariable analysis, however, ΣSTR is the stronger prognostic variable. © The European Society of Cardiology 2005. All rights reserved.
